Ministry of Environment Extends Deadline for National Innovation Competitions to Combat Plastic Pollution

The Ministry of Environment has announced the extension of the deadline for submitting applications for national innovation competitions dedicated to combating plastic pollution. Tunisian startups now have until August 10, 2025, to submit their projects.

The call is addressed to young Tunisian companies developing innovative solutions in three key areas:

  • Reducing and substituting single-use plastic
  • Recycling and valorization within a circular economy framework
  • Technologies for tracking and controlling plastic pollution

This initiative is led by the United Nations Development Programme (UNDP), in partnership with the Tunisian Ministry of Environment and with the support of the Government of the People's Republic of China.

Selected projects will benefit from financial support, personalized guidance, and opportunities for international networking. The goal is to support ideas that can contribute to sustainable waste management while promoting green entrepreneurship.
